The Downspout Failure Water Damage Restoration Process: What to Expect
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. From initial assessment to final inspection, we’ll guide you through every step of the way. A proper process is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a successful restoration.
Step 1: Emergency Response
Respond quickly to minimize damage and prevent further water intrusion. Our team will arrive within hours to assess the situation and begin the restoration process.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Remove excess water using state-of-the-art equipment to prevent further damage and promote drying.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and structural dam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, ensuring your property is thoroughly dried and free of moisture.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Restore your property to its original condition by cleaning and sanitizing all surfaces, removing any remaining moisture and debris.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ion
Ensure your property is safe and secure by conducting a thorough final inspection. We’ll provide you with a detailed report and recommendations for any future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Downspout Failure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and further damage. Stay ahead of the game by recognizing these common indicators: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Don’t ignore musty smells that linger after a storm. This could be a sign of water intrusion and potential mold growth.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Act quickly if you notice water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ings. This indicates water damage and potential structural issues.
Discolored or Warped Flooring
Check your flooring for signs of water damage, including discoloration, warping, or buckling.
Visible Water Leaks
Don’t wait to address visible water leaks, as they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Unusual Sounds or Squeaks
Listen carefully for unusual sounds or squeaks that may indicate water damage or structural issues.

Downspout Failure Water Damage Restoration Cost in Wolf Creek, UT
Prices for downspout failure water damage restoration v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ect the actual cost of your specific project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and materials needed. |
| Final Inspection and Completion |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the project. |
| Emergency Response | $100 – $500 | Time of day and urgency of the situation. |

Common Questions About Downspout Failure Water Damage Restoration
Q: What is the typical timeline for downspout failure water damage restoration?
Our team works efficiently to restore your property, usually within 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the project.
Q: Is downspout failure water damage restoration covered by insurance?
Yes, in most cases, downspout failure water damage restoration is covered by homeowners insurance. However, it’s essential to review your policy and contact your insurance provider to confirm.
Q: Can I prevent downspout failure water damage?
Yes, with regular maintenance, you can prevent downspout failure water damage. Regularly inspect and clean your downspouts, and consider installing a gutter guard to reduce debris buildup.
Q: What equipment do you use for downspout failure water damage restoration?
We use state-of-the-art equipment, including industrial-strength pumps, dehumidifiers, and drying equipment to ensure efficient and effective restoration.
